Bug Description
An Akonadi resoruce is crashing every few hours. The Crash Reporting Assistent pops up. "Install Debug Symbols" installed kdepim-runtime-dbg, but anyway the assistent insists that the debug symbols are missing:
> The packages containing debug information for the following application and libraries are missing:
> /usr/bin/
Version is 4:15.08.2-0ubuntu1 of all kdepim-runtime, kdepim-runtime-dbg and akonadi-server
I am on Kubuntu 15.10
